Cranberries grow on low creeping shrubs. The berry is initially light green, turning red when ripe.
As fresh cranberries are hard and bitter, generally cranberry is processed (with added sugars), into cranberry sauces and juices. Cranberry juice can contain as much as one teaspoon of sugar per fluid ounce.
Cranberry supplements were developed as a way of taking cranberry without all the added sugars.
